Forty-eight years ago today, the dream began.
With the first ever Ruby run on St. Patricks Day 1977 off Cass House Peak in the southern Rubies.
48 years later, the dream lives on.
Five runs today in Conrad Creek with strong winds ahead of an incoming storm system.
Eight to ten inches of new snow is expected overnight for tomorrow.
We are looking forward to a refresh after three days of pounding wind.
